Santaldih Primary School: A Profile of a Rural West Bengal Institution

Santaldih Primary School, a government-run institution in the rural heart of West Bengal, stands as a testament to the commitment to education in even the most remote areas. Established in 1955 under the Department of Education, this co-educational school serves the community of Raghunathpur-II block in Purulia district. Catering to students from Class 1 to Class 4, it offers a vital foundation for the children of the region.

The school's infrastructure reflects its dedication to providing a conducive learning environment. Housed in a government building, it boasts four well-maintained classrooms, providing ample space for instruction. The school also features a functional library, well-stocked with 102 books, offering students access to enriching supplementary materials. The presence of both boys' and girls' toilets ensures a safe and hygienic learning environment for all students. Reliable hand pumps provide access to clean drinking water, a crucial aspect of a healthy school setting. Importantly, the school's pucca boundary wall and electricity connection contribute to a secure and well-equipped learning space.

The school's academic approach is tailored to the needs of its students. Instruction is provided in Bengali, catering to the linguistic background of the community. A significant feature of Santaldih Primary School is its attached pre-primary section, which allows for early childhood education, nurturing a smooth transition into primary learning. The availability of a mid-day meal program further supports students' overall well-being, ensuring proper nutrition contributes to their educational progress.

The teaching staff at Santaldih comprises a single male teacher, dedicated to shaping the young minds under their tutelage.
